Q: iPhone or iPad sometimes "dismount" from Photos and will not mount again
Hello all,
Weekends I normally have Photos app on and both my iPhone 6s plus and iPad mini 4 will be seen mount on it on the left column. (on my iMac)
Sometimes intermittently I would notice one of them would "disappear" from the left hand side column under the 'Import' tab, e.g. either the iPad mini 4 or the iPhone, I remove/unplug the device, plug in again, but it fails to mount, i.e. if I have new photos to import from the iOS device (and choose to delete from the device) I can't do it.
I kind of know at least the USB cables and the mounting "works" because I can see both devices in iTunes.
I've tried:
- Off and On the iOS device
- Plug/unplug USB cable, even change port behind iMac
- Quit & relaunch Photos app
All above failed to work.
The only working way to have see both devices again seem to be rebooting the iMac. That's not something I want to do often.
